Output fa0a4beeace021b501acd645d0e1c7e1ca9708b88c2c8a6e5edf9451ed55909e:1

value
11472827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52d8a31ec2ebb0beb25e0a80ae33a88fa173fc6 OP_EQUAL
address
3M8CQZnbRG7J9zFW5gHtPHvusod7pKmteP
transaction
fa0a4beeace021b501acd645d0e1c7e1ca9708b88c2c8a6e5edf9451ed55909e
confirmations
281960
spent
true